The invention relates to a small household capacitor deionization water purifier, comprising a microfiltration filter, an activated carbon filter A, and a capacitor water treatment module connected in sequence; and a control unit, the control unit including a PCB control cabinet , a DC regulated power supply and a DC watt-hour meter are installed in the PCB control cabinet, the DC regulated power supply and the capacitance method water treatment module are connected to form a loop through a line, and the DC watt-hour meter is connected in parallel on the line connecting the two; A post-treatment unit for produced water, the post-treatment unit for produced water includes a fresh water tank and a concentrated water tank, the fresh water tank and the concentrated water tank are respectively connected to the capacitance method water treatment module through a connecting pipeline, and the two connecting pipes A solenoid valve is installed on the road. The advantage of the present invention is that: compared with the existing mainstream water purification technology, the household capacitance method water purifier provided by the invention uses the capacitance method water purification technology to treat impurities in tap water, and has a very high purification effect.

目前,家用净水器在国内已得到了一定程度的普及。市场上家用净水器虽然种类繁多,但基本是以膜法净水为基础的,包括:微滤、纳滤、超滤、反渗透膜法。其中,微滤与纳滤技术多作为净水设备的预处理手段;超滤技术是目前国内使用最为广泛的净水技术;反渗透膜法多应用于高端净水器。尽管膜法净水器有着良好的净水效果,但在使用过程中滤芯会被水中的杂货污染、堵塞,净水效果将会明显下降;并且,滤芯需要定期更换,增加了较高的使用成本;另外,由于膜法设备工作时,需要较高的进水压力,因此该类进水器需要安装增压泵以提高进水压力,增加了设备复杂性与电能的消耗。At present, household water purifiers have been popularized to a certain extent in China. Although there are many types of household water purifiers on the market, they are basically based on membrane water purification, including: microfiltration, nanofiltration, ultrafiltration, and reverse osmosis membrane methods. Among them, microfiltration and nanofiltration technologies are mostly used as pretreatment methods for water purification equipment; ultrafiltration technology is currently the most widely used water purification technology in China; reverse osmosis membrane method is mostly used in high-end water purifiers. Although the membrane water purifier has a good water purification effect, the filter element will be polluted and blocked by groceries in the water during use, and the water purification effect will be significantly reduced; moreover, the filter element needs to be replaced regularly, which increases the use cost ; In addition, because membrane equipment requires high water inlet pressure when working, this type of water inlet needs to be installed with a booster pump to increase the water inlet pressure, which increases the complexity of the equipment and the consumption of electric energy.

电容法净水技术绿色环保、无需添加药剂只消耗电能,无二次污染;其电极可实现再生,有较长的使用寿命,无需频繁更换,且活性炭电极价格低廉,降低了设备生产与运行成本。、Capacitive water purification technology is green and environmentally friendly, does not need to add chemicals, only consumes electric energy, and has no secondary pollution; its electrodes can be regenerated, have a long service life, and do not need to be replaced frequently, and the price of activated carbon electrodes is low, which reduces equipment production and operating costs . ,
另外,管道中自来水的压力足够满足该进水器工作需要,因此本发明无需额外的增压泵,即降低了装置的复杂性。In addition, the pressure of tap water in the pipeline is sufficient to meet the working requirements of the water inlet, so the present invention does not require an additional booster pump, which reduces the complexity of the device.
对于电容法水处理模块采用修饰改性的活性炭电极作为处理单元,其易于成套制造,便于系统组装与维护。The modified activated carbon electrode is used as the processing unit for the capacitive water treatment module, which is easy to manufacture in a complete set and facilitates system assembly and maintenance.

工作原理:自来水经过微滤过滤器及活性炭过滤器A1处理后,进入电容法水处理模块3,该模块离子截留率保持在75%以上,电容法水处理模块3加载直流电压,由P PCB控制柜5控制电压的转换与电磁阀的开闭,电容法水处理模块除杂(吸附)阶段加载正向电压,其产水作为淡水经过活性炭过滤器B7后进入淡水箱8收集,电极单元吸附饱和后加载电压反接,此时淡水出水口电磁阀关闭,浓水出口电磁阀打开,由进水对电极单元进行冲洗脱附,并作为浓水排入浓水箱9,该浓水杂质含量相对较低,由浓水箱9收集留作他用;脱附结束后加载电压正接,淡水出口与浓水出口的电磁阀延迟30秒转换开闭,以保证良好的净化效果。Working principle: After the tap water is treated by microfiltration filter and activated carbon filter A1, it enters the capacitive method water treatment module 3, and the ion retention rate of this module is kept above 75%. The capacitive method water treatment module 3 is loaded with DC voltage and controlled by P PCB Cabinet 5 controls the conversion of the voltage and the opening and closing of the solenoid valve. The capacitive water treatment module is loaded with a positive voltage during the impurity removal (adsorption) stage, and the produced water is collected as fresh water through the activated carbon filter B7 and then enters the fresh water tank 8. The electrode unit is saturated with adsorption After the voltage is reversed, the fresh water outlet solenoid valve is closed, the concentrated water outlet solenoid valve is opened, and the electrode unit is flushed and desorbed by the incoming water, and discharged into the concentrated water tank 9 as concentrated water. The concentration of impurities in the concentrated water is relatively high. Low, collected by the concentrated water tank 9 for other use; after the desorption is completed, the load voltage is positively connected, and the solenoid valves of the fresh water outlet and the concentrated water outlet are switched on and off with a delay of 30 seconds to ensure a good purification effect.
